| Experience |
| I began my career in real estate in 1990. I have been involved in the Skagit County Association of Realtors consistently, including serving on, and chairing the Education Committee. From 1993 through 1997 I served on the Board of Directors for the Association. In 1993, I acquired my Graduate Realtors Institute designation. |
| Community Involvement |
| I have been a member of the Mount Vernon Soroptimist for 21 years. In April, 2003 I received the Woman of Distinquish Award from the Mount Vernon Soroptimist, which is based on outstanding achievements in professional business & voluntary activities during a period of at least 10 years. I also currently serve on the Sedro Woolley High School Advisory Committee for the Business Department, and on the United General Hospital Foundation board and have served two years as president, and am a commissioner for Clear Lake Cemetery. In 1992 I was awarded the Realtor Community Service Award and in 1996, the Distinguished Service Award. It has always been important to me to give back to the community that has been good to me throughout the years. |
